StratiSERV is SteelDome’s software-defined virtualization and orchestration platform, built to simplify the deployment, management, and scaling of modern compute infrastructure.
Designed to support both virtual machines and containerized workloads, StratiSERV gives organizations a unified platform for running traditional applications, cloud-native services, and mixed workload environments under a single operational model. This allows teams to reduce management complexity, improve infrastructure efficiency, and maintain greater control across core, edge, and hybrid deployments.
Built on a high-performance, hardware-agnostic foundation, StratiSERV enables enterprises to move beyond proprietary hypervisor ecosystems while preserving the performance, resilience, and flexibility required for production environments. It supports centralized workload management, high availability, live migration, role-based access control, GPU-enabled workloads, and deep integration with modern automation and container frameworks.
Whether deployed as a standalone virtualization platform or as part of a broader HyperSERV architecture with StratiSTOR, StratiSERV provides a modern compute foundation for private cloud, VDI, AI infrastructure, edge computing, and multi-tenant service delivery.

StratiSERV is built to support multiple deployment architectures so organizations can align compute strategy with operational, performance, and business requirements.
StratiSERV can be deployed on dedicated compute infrastructure connected to centralized or distributed StratiSTOR storage. This model allows compute and storage resources to scale independently and is well suited for environments that prefer architectural separation and specialized resource planning.
When deployed alongside StratiSTOR as part of HyperSERV, StratiSERV enables a hyperconverged model in which compute and storage services run together on the same nodes. This approach simplifies management, reduces infrastructure footprint, and supports highly efficient deployments across enterprise and edge environments.
StratiSERV also supports distributed and multi-site architectures that span data centers, hybrid environments, and federated operational models. This gives organizations the flexibility to align workload placement, continuity planning, and infrastructure growth with real-world deployment needs.
